Understanding Crabgrass Prevention

Crabgrass is a type of weed that thrives in warm-season grasses during the summer months. It spreads rapidly and can quickly overrun your lawn if not properly addressed. Prevention is key when it comes to managing crabgrass and maintaining a healthy lawn.

Crabgrass prevention involves taking proactive measures to stop the weed seeds from germinating and taking root in your lawn. This is where products like Scotts Crabgrass Preventer Plus Fertilizer come into play. These products not only prevent crabgrass growth but also provide essential nutrients to promote the healthy growth of your existing grass.

Scotts Crabgrass Preventer Plus Fertilizer works by forming a barrier on the surface of your lawn, preventing crabgrass seeds from germinating. As the weed seeds come into contact with the preventer, they are unable to develop and eventually die off. This proactive approach helps to ensure that your lawn remains free from the invasion of crabgrass throughout the growing season.

One key feature of Scotts Crabgrass Preventer Plus Fertilizer is that it contains a balanced blend of essential nutrients. This helps to nourish your existing grass, promoting thicker and healthier growth. The fertilizer component of the product provides a boost of n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ium, which are vital for strong root development and overall lawn health.

It’s important to note that crabgrass tends to thrive in areas with thin or weak grass. That’s why maintaining a thick and robust lawn is critical for preventing crabgrass from taking hold. By regularly maintaining your grass through proper watering, mowing, and fertilization, you can help create an environment that is less susceptible to crabgrass invasion.

Factors to Consider Before Applying

Before applying Scotts Crabgrass Preventer Plus Fertilizer, there are several important factors to consider to ensure that you achieve the best results:

  1. Grass type: Different grass species have different tolerance levels to weed preventers. It’s crucial to determine if your lawn consists of cool-season grasses or warm-season grasses. Scotts Crabgrass Preventer Plus Fertilizer is safe to use on most cool-season grasses, such as Kentucky bluegrass, tall fescue, and perennial ryegrass. However, it is not recommended for use on or near certain warm-season grasses like St. Augustinegrass, centipedegrass, or dichondra. Always read the product label carefully to ensure compatibility with your specific grass type.
  2. Growing conditions: It’s essential to consider the current and upcoming weather conditions before applying Scotts Crabgrass Preventer Plus Fertilizer. Ideally, you should apply the product when the soil temperature reaches around 55°F (13°C) for four to five consecutive days. This timing is crucial as it coincides with the germination period of crabgrass seeds. Additionally, it’s best to avoid applying the preventer when heavy rainfall is expected, as it can wash away the product before it can be absorbed by the soil.
  3. Recent lawn activities: Before applying any lawn treatment, consider recent activities such as seeding, aerating, or dethatching. If you have recently seeded your lawn or plan to do so, it’s important to wait at least eight weeks before applying Scotts Crabgrass Preventer Plus Fertilizer, as it can hinder the germination of new grass seeds.
  4. Existing weeds: Scotts Crabgrass Preventer Plus Fertilizer is a preventive treatment and is not effective against existing weeds. If your lawn already has visible crabgrass or other weeds, it’s recommended to use a post-emergent herbicide specifically designed to target those weeds before applying the preventer. This will help ensure that the preventer can work optimally to stop new weed growth.
  5. Timing of fertilizer application: If you are planning to fertilize your lawn, it’s important to consider the timing in relation to the application of Scotts Crabgrass Preventer Plus Fertilizer. Applying both at the same time can risk over-fertilization, which can damage your grass. It’s generally recommended to wait at least 6-8 weeks after applying the preventer before applying any additional fertilizer.

By taking these factors into consideration, you can maximize the effectiveness of Scotts Crabgrass Preventer Plus Fertilizer and ensure optimal results for your lawn.

When to Apply Scotts Crabgrass Preventer Plus Fertilizer

Timing is crucial when it comes to applying Scotts Crabgrass Preventer Plus Fertilizer for optimal crabgrass control. The goal is to apply the product before crabgrass seeds germinate and take root in your lawn. Here are some key guidelines to follow:

  1. Soil temperature: The ideal time to apply Scotts Crabgrass Preventer Plus Fertilizer is when the soil temperature reaches around 55°F (13°C) for four to five consecutive days. This is typically when crabgrass seeds begin to germinate. You can use a soil thermometer to monitor the temperature or consult local gardening resources for information about soil temperature in your area.
  2. Timing in relation to grass growth: It’s important to apply the preventer before your grass starts actively growing. For cool-season grasses, such as Kentucky bluegrass and tall fescue, early spring (around late March to early April) is an ideal time. For warm-season grasses, the timing may vary depending on your location. Consult local experts or resources specific to your grass type for the best time to apply the preventer.
  3. Avoiding heavy rainfall: It’s best to apply Scotts Crabgrass Preventer Plus Fertilizer when there is no heavy rainfall expected within the next 24 to 48 hours. Heavy rainfall can wash away the product before it has a chance to be absorbed by the soil, reducing its effectiveness. If rainfall is imminent, consider postponing the application until the weather conditions improve.
  4. Considering grass seeding: If you plan to seed your lawn, it’s important to wait at least eight weeks after seeding before applying the preventer. This allows the new grass seeds to establish and minimize interference with their germination. Applying the preventer too soon can hinder the growth of new grass.

By following these guidelines and considering local climate and grass growth patterns, you can determine the best time to apply Scotts Crabgrass Preventer Plus Fertilizer for maximum effectiveness in preventing crabgrass infestation. Remember to always read and follow the instructions provided by the manufacturer.

Proper Application Techniques

To achieve optimal results when applying Scotts Crabgrass Preventer Plus Fertilizer, it is important to follow the proper techniques to ensure even coverage and effective weed prevention. Here are some key steps to consider:

  1. Read the instructions: Start by carefully reading and understanding the instructions provided by the manufacturer. This will ensure that you are aware of any specific guidelines or precautions for applying the product.
  2. Prepare the lawn: Before applying the preventer, mow your lawn to the proper height. This will help the product reach the soil more effectively and ensure even distribution.
  3. Calculate the right amount: Measure the area of your lawn to determine the correct amount of Scotts Crabgrass Preventer Plus Fertilizer needed for application. This can be done using a measuring wheel or by referring to the product label for coverage information.
  4. Use a spreader: To ensure even distribution, it is recommended to use a broadcast spreader or a handheld spreader. These tools help to spread the granular product evenly over the entire lawn area, ensuring uniform coverage.
  5. Apply in a crisscross pattern: When applying the preventer, start by walking along one edge of your lawn, spreading the product in a straight line parallel to the edge. Then, walk in a perpendicular direction and spread the product in a straight line across the first application area. This crisscross pattern helps ensure even coverage and prevents any missed spots.
  6. Overlap slightly: During the application, make sure to overlap each pass slightly to avoid any gaps in coverage. This will help ensure that the entire lawn area receives the necessary amount of product for effective crabgrass prevention.
  7. Water after application: After applying Scotts Crabgrass Preventer Plus Fertilizer, lightly water the lawn to help activate the product and allow it to penetrate the soil. This ensures the preventer forms a protective barrier for enhanced weed control.
  8. Clean and store the spreader: After use, thoroughly clean the spreader to remove any remaining product. Properly store the spreader in a dry and secure location for future use.

By following these proper application techniques, you can ensure that Scotts Crabgrass Preventer Plus Fertilizer is evenly spread across your lawn, providing effective control against crabgrass and promoting healthy grass growth.

Maintenance and Follow-Up Care

Proper maintenance and follow-up care are essential to ensure the long-term effectiveness of Scotts Crabgrass Preventer Plus Fertilizer and maintain a healthy, weed-free lawn. Here are some important steps to consider:

  1. Watering: Adequate watering is key to activate the preventer and ensure it penetrates the soil. After application, lightly water the lawn to help the product form a protective barrier and provide effective crabgrass control. However, avoid excessive watering, as it can dilute the product or wash it away, reducing its effectiveness.
  2. Mowing: Maintain the proper mowing height for your specific grass type to promote healthy growth. Avoid cutting the grass too short, as this can weaken the grass and make it more susceptible to weed invasion. Regularly mowing your lawn at the recommended height helps to remove any new weed growth and promote the denser growth of your grass.
  3. Weed control: While Scotts Crabgrass Preventer Plus Fertilizer provides effective crabgrass prevention, it may not control all types of weeds. It’s important to monitor your lawn for any signs of weed growth and address them promptly. Consider using a post-emergent herbicide to target and eliminate any weeds that manage to sprout. Always follow the instructions and guidelines provided by the herbicide manufacturer.
  4. Fertilization: While Scotts Crabgrass Preventer Plus Fertilizer contains a balanced nutrient blend, additional fertilization may be required to maintain the health and vitality of your lawn. Follow a fertilizer schedule suited to your grass type’s needs, applying the right amount of fertilizer at the correct times of the year. Avoid over-fertilizing, as this can lead to excessive growth and weaken the grass.
  5. Regular maintenance: Regular lawn care practices such as proper watering, mowing, and fertilization are essential for maintaining a healthy and weed-free lawn. Follow recommended guidelines for your specific grass type to ensure optimal growth and minimize the risk of weed invasion. Regularly inspect your lawn for any signs of weeds or lawn diseases, and take appropriate action to address them promptly.

By consistently implementing these maintenance and follow-up care practices, you can maximize the effectiveness of Scotts Crabgrass Preventer Plus Fertilizer and ensure that your lawn remains healthy, vibrant, and free from crabgrass and other unwanted weeds.
